Tony Parker (ankle) questionable for Spurs on Wednesday

San Antonio Spurs point guard Tony Parker (left ankle) is questionable against the Orlando Magic on Wednesday.

What It Means:

Parker suffered a small tweak during the first half of Tuesday's game, but he was able to play through it. If the Spurs choose to be cautious with him, he could easily sit this one out. Patrick Mills and Ray McCallum would see more run if Parker is forced to the sidelines.

Parker owns a 6.2 nERD, which ranks 23rd, in 48 games played this season. He's averaging 12.0 points, 5.1 assists and 2.6 rebounds per game while posting a 56.3 True Shooting Percentage. If Parker is able to face Orlando, we project him to score 12.3 points, dish out 4.8 assists and grab 2.6 boards while shooting 51.0 percent from the field.
